if you can drive the dana 35 is a fine axle. 33" or smaller tires.
seeing as the 35 is the stock axle for oh i dont know, about 2.5 million jeeps, staying away from it will be almost impossible
i know plenty of guys who have wheeled the crap out of a dana 35 with no issues, you can brake any axle, i have seen 60s snap going over a 12 inch shelf
best bang for the buck is a cherokee, 1996 and newer are safer, that is when they went to a structural roof, anything older you will want a roll cage if you do ay serious wheeling at all. i know this first hand.![]()
